| Sorry to be a pain folks, but this has me stumped and getting angry now… My earlier post explains the history so far, so I won’t go over it again…except to say that turning the ignition key results in nothing…. I’ve attached a picture of the 1.9D cube’s starter motor… POST A is where two large red cables are attached…one from the battery and one that seems to go to the alternator…. Post B is the link from the solenoid through to the starter body…. Terminal C has a plug with a yellow wire coming from god knows where… So…. With the motor in the van I have a permanent live at post A, but not at B….even with the key turned…. With the motor out of the van and a battery used directly…neg to motor body and battery live to post A…nothing happens…. If I put the battery live to post B I get a solenoid action and a fast spinning shaft So…is the solenoid **&**erd? |
